What Are Porcelain Veneers?
Porcelain veneers are customized shells designed to cover the front surface of your teeth. They are made from high-quality dental porcelain, a material known for its strength and ability to mimic the natural shine and texture of real teeth.
What Do They Fix?
Porcelain veneers are popular for fixing common cosmetic dental issues such as:
- Discolored or stained teeth that don’t respond well to whitening
- Chips or cracks that affect the appearance of your smile
- Small gaps between teeth that make you feel self-conscious
- Minor misalignments or uneven teeth that impact your smile’s symmetry
Why Choose Porcelain Veneers?
One of the key benefits of porcelain veneers is their exceptional durability. With proper care, they can last many years without losing their natural look. They blend beautifully with your other teeth, creating a flawless yet natural-looking smile.

The Two-Visit Process Explained
Getting porcelain veneers is a straightforward process that typically occurs over two main dental visits. Here’s what to expect during each step of the process:
First Visit: Consultation and Preparation
The very first appointment is all about getting to know your smile and preparing your teeth for the veneers.
- Initial Evaluation and Smile Assessment: Your dentist will carefully examine your teeth and discuss what you want to achieve. This is the time to share your smile goals and ask questions.
- Tooth Preparation: To make room for the veneers, a tiny bit of enamel (the outer layer of your teeth) is gently shaved down. This step ensures the veneers will fit naturally and look perfect.
- Impressions: After preparing your teeth, your dentist will take precise molds or impressions of your mouth. These impressions are sent to a dental lab where your custom veneers will be made.
- Temporary Veneers: Unlike permanent veneers, their temporary versions are placed to protect your teeth and give you a preview of your new smile.
Second Visit: Final Placement
Once your custom veneers are ready, you’ll come back for the final fitting.
- Custom Veneers Created in a Lab: Skilled technicians craft each veneer to match your teeth’s shape, size, and color exactly.
- Bonding Procedure: The veneers are carefully bonded to your teeth using a special dental adhesive. Your dentist will make sure each veneer fits perfectly.
- Final Adjustments: Any minor tweaks are made to ensure your bite feels comfortable and your smile looks natural.
- Immediate Smile Transformation: Once everything is in place, you’ll leave with a beautiful, confident new smile!
Benefits of Choosing Porcelain Veneers
Porcelain veneers are a popular choice for individuals seeking to enhance their smile with natural-looking results. Here are some key benefits:
Aesthetic Enhancement & Confidence Boost
Veneers give your teeth a smooth, bright, and even appearance. Because they look so natural, many people feel more confident smiling and speaking in front of others.
Long-Lasting Results
With proper care, porcelain veneers can last between 10 and 15 years. This means you get a beautiful smile that stands the test of time.
Stain Resistance & Low Maintenance
Porcelain is very resistant to stains from coffee, tea, or smoking. You don’t need any special products; just regular brushing and flossing are enough to keep them looking great.
Minimally Invasive
Veneers require only a small amount of tooth enamel to be removed. This makes the procedure less invasive while still giving excellent results.

Aftercare and Maintenance Tips
Taking good care of your teeth after getting veneers helps them last longer and maintain their appearance. Here are some simple tips to follow:
1. Practice Daily Oral Hygiene
- Brush your teeth twice a day with a soft-bristled toothbrush.
- Use a non-abrasive toothpaste to avoid scratching the veneers.
- Don’t forget to floss daily to keep your gums healthy and prevent plaque buildup.
2. Avoid Damaging Habits
- Stay away from hard foods like ice, nuts, or hard candies that can chip your veneers.
- If you grind your teeth at night, ask your dentist about getting a nightguard to protect your smile.
3. Visit Your Dentist Regularly
- Schedule dental check-ups every six months.
- Your dentist will monitor your veneers and clean areas you can’t reach at home, helping them last for years.
Following these simple habits will keep your veneers looking bright and your natural teeth healthy.
